About

To describe the general trajectories of rehabilitation compliance in first-onset stroke patients within 6 months, and to identify the heterogeneous development trajectory of different subgroups based on the mixed model of latent growth.To explore the predictors of different change tracks of rehabilitation compliance of stroke patients from the perspectives of biological, psychological and social factors, so as to provide the basis for formulating precise nursing intervention measures.

Full description

To describe the general trajectories of rehabilitation compliance in first-onset stroke patients within 6 months. To recruit first-onset stroke patients undergoing rehabilitation and collect the general data. Telephone follow-up at 2 weeks, 6 weeks, 8 weeks, 12 weeks and 24 weeks after the onset. Based on the biological-psychosocial medical model and literature, biological, psychological and sociological factors were screened. The patient rehabilitation adherence level in different periods was measured. Latent Growth Mixture Model (LGMM) was used to investigate the general trend of rehabilitation compliance in patients with first-episode stroke within 6 months. Latent Class Growth Analysis (LCGA) method in Latent Growth hybrid model was used to identify the track of heterogeneous change. Multivariate Logistic regression analysis was used to explore the predictors of different subgroups of change trajectories relative to other subgroups.

Inclusion criteria

  • Patients diagnosed with stroke by CT or MR;

    • Patients with first onset (within 14 days of onset); ③ limb dysfunction (muscle strength ≤4); ④ Age: ≥18 years old; ⑤ Awareness (NIHSS consciousness level ≤1 point);

      • Informed consent of patients.

Exclusion criteria

  • Patients with deep vein thrombosis;

    • fracture patients;

      • a history of severe cardiopulmonary dysfunction and craniocerebral trauma;

        • recurrent stroke during the study; ⑤patients with severe mental disorders; ⑥ Mixed aphasia patients.
